Cancun Golf Passport Info

 

(1) You must make your own reservations. Discount is not valid if you use an on-line booking website, travel agent, concierge or anyone else. We cannot express this point strongly enough.

(2) You MUST present the CGP at the Pro Shop at time of check in.

(3) Discount is 30% off & valid on the regularly posted public rates at each golf course. Public rates may vary from season to season and/or twilight hours. Some courses do not allow discount on twilight rates.

(4) The CGP is valid for one reservation and one discounted green fee. You can play alone or in a foursome. However, only the card holder will get the discount.

(5) The CGP is valid for unlimited visits throughout 2011 at each participating course.

(6) Each course has the right to refuse the discount if they are hosting private events, golf tournaments, corporate functions or any other group bookings. Larger events are normally booked several months in advance; however, you should reconfirm your tee-time once you check into your hotel. Discounts not valid with any other coupon, promotion or special and ONLY when you make the reservation directly.

(7) CGP holders are subject to the rules at each course. Proper golf attire required.

(8) Rates and times are subject to change by participating courses. CGP will try to keep up with any changes that might occur; however, CGP cannot be held liable for time or rate changes. Certain restrictions may apply with each course.

(9) Participating Courses have full control over their discounts and exceptions.

(10) The 2011 CGP expires December 1, 2011.
